Teofil
See also: Teófil
Polish
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/tɛˈɔ.fil/
Audio (file) - Rhymes: -ɔfil
- Syllabification: Te‧o‧fil
Etymology 1
Borrowed from Latin Theophilus, from Ancient Greek Θεόφιλος (Theóphilos).
Proper noun
Teofil m pers (feminine Teofila)
- a male given name, equivalent to English Theophilus
Declension
Declension of Teofil
singular | plural | |
---|---|---|
nominative | Teofil | Teofilowie |
genitive | Teofila | Teofili |
dative | Teofilowi | Teofilom |
accusative | Teofila | Teofili |
instrumental | Teofilem | Teofilami |
locative | Teofilu | Teofilach |
vocative | Teofilu | Teofilowie |
